I could be wrong on this but it looks like the top broken off one of those ash trays where you push down on the top(what you have) and then the plate you have snubbed your cigerette out on spins and makes the ash and butt disapear into the bottom chamber eliminating smoke and smell. The part you have looks as tho it has been broken off and someone may have sharpened it for the use of a screwdriver.
